How to Calculate Customer Lifetime Value (LTV)
Lifetime value tells you what a customer is actually worth — after costs. Calculate it honestly and every acquisition decision gets sharper. Inflate it and you will overspend.
Customer lifetime value (LTV, sometimes CLV or CLTV) is the total profit you expect from a customer across the whole relationship. Paired with CAC, it answers the question every growth team must be able to defend: is each customer worth more than it costs to acquire them?
The honest formula: margin-adjusted LTV
The most common mistake is calculating LTV on revenue instead of profit. Revenue-based LTV overstates value dramatically for any business with meaningful cost of goods. Use the margin-adjusted version:
LTV = ARPU × gross margin × average customer lifespan
Where ARPU is average revenue per customer per period (often monthly), gross margin is the fraction of revenue left after the direct cost of serving the customer, and lifespan is how many periods the average customer stays.
Two ways to get lifespan
1. Lifespan-based (simple)
If you know your average customer lifespan directly — say, 24 months — plug it in. Straightforward, but circular for young companies that do not yet have real lifespan data.
2. Churn-based (better for subscriptions)
For subscription businesses, derive lifespan from churn. The average lifespan of a customer is the inverse of the churn rate:
Average lifespan (months) = 1 ÷ monthly churn rate
So a 4% monthly churn rate implies an average lifespan of 1 ÷ 0.04 = 25 months. Combined with the margin formula, this gives:
LTV = (ARPU × gross margin) ÷ monthly churn rate
Churn-based LTV is powerful but sensitive: at low churn rates a tiny change swings LTV wildly, and it assumes churn stays constant, which it rarely does. Treat the output as a planning estimate, not a promise.
A worked example
ARPU is $120/month, gross margin is 80%, and average lifespan is 24 months. Then LTV = $120 × 0.80 × 24 = $2,304. If your CAC is $250, your LTV:CAC ratio is about 9:1. You can compute all of this at once — including CAC payback — in the unit-economics calculator.
Mistakes that inflate LTV
- Using revenue, not margin. The biggest and most common inflation.
- Assuming zero churn drift. Early cohorts churn faster; blending them with mature cohorts can flatter lifespan.
- Ignoring discounts and refunds. Net revenue, not gross bookings.
- Extrapolating from too little data. Predicting a 5-year lifespan from six months of history is guesswork. Use ranges.
- Counting expansion you have not earned. Upsell can raise LTV, but only model it once you have evidence it happens reliably.
Historical vs. predictive LTV
There are two broad ways to arrive at LTV, and confusing them causes most disputes. Historical LTV sums the actual margin a cohort has generated to date — accurate but backward-looking, and it undercounts customers who are still active. Predictive LTV uses the formulas above (or a statistical model) to forecast the full lifetime value, including revenue not yet earned. Predictive LTV is what you compare against CAC when deciding how much to spend, because CAC is paid upfront to capture a future stream. The trap is mixing them: comparing a fully-predicted LTV against a conservative historical CAC, or vice versa, produces a ratio that means nothing. Pick one basis and apply it consistently on both sides of the equation. For young companies with thin history, present predictive LTV as a range across optimistic and pessimistic churn assumptions rather than a single confident figure — it keeps everyone honest about how much is forecast versus observed.
How LTV drives decisions
LTV is not a vanity number — it sets your acquisition budget. If a customer is worth $2,300 in margin, you can afford a meaningfully higher CAC than if they are worth $300. The relationship between the two is captured by the LTV:CAC ratio, and the speed of recovery by the CAC payback period. Frequently asked questions
What is the difference between LTV and CLV?
They are the same thing — LTV (lifetime value) and CLV/CLTV (customer lifetime value) are interchangeable terms for the total profit expected from a customer over the relationship.
Should LTV use revenue or profit?
Profit. Multiply by gross margin so you measure margin-adjusted LTV. Revenue-based LTV overstates value for any business with meaningful cost of goods and encourages overspending on acquisition.
How do I calculate lifespan from churn?
Average customer lifespan in months is approximately 1 divided by the monthly churn rate. A 4% monthly churn implies about a 25-month lifespan. This assumes churn stays roughly constant, so treat it as an estimate.
Why is my churn-based LTV so volatile?
Because LTV is inversely proportional to churn. At low churn rates, a small change in churn produces a large swing in LTV. Use a range of churn assumptions rather than a single point estimate.
